Serve healthy kid-friendly food with sustainable fish
If it tastes good, even the pickiest tykes in your family will eat what's good for them. Take a look at a couple of fish-based recipe ideas from Janes. These menu ideas stand out in a crowd because they are made with salmon and haddock from sustainable sources, certified by the Marine Stewardship Council and identified by the MSC eco-label on Janes packaging:
Fish Tacos: Sprinkle cilantro, shredded lettuce, sliced red onions, red peppers over warm tortillas. Cut prepared battered haddock into pieces; divide between tortillas. Top each filled tortilla with corn or mango salsa.
Pan-Asian Salmon Burger: Add Asian flair: Brush salmon burgers with teriyaki sauce during the last minutes of cooking. Transfer to sesame seed bun, top with avocado, cucumber, a little wasabi or regular mayonnaise.
